Title :
A weighted Mahalanobis distance Hough transform and its application for the detection of circular segments

Abstract :
A weighted Mahalanobis distance transform with extended Kalman filter refinement is proposed. It is shown to detect feature points more flexibly in a predefined range around the contour, using low-resolution accumulating arrays, and iterations in incremental jumps
